One of the things about boundaries is that its not about what you want them to do its about what you will do or not do (its all about you)
so on the financials it is NOT 'I want you to pay more'
it is more 'Given our current circumstances I will now only be paying 50% of the household bills. Should our circumstances change then I am happy to review this arrangement'
ok the phrasing isnt great but hopefully you get the idea
